Financial blocks are deep psychological patterns that prevent money from flowing freely into your life. They manifest as anxiety, fear of money, low self-esteem, and disbelief in financial success. These limitations reside in the subconscious, making them difficult to recognize and eliminate.
Such blocks begin forming in childhood. Upbringing, environment, and societal norms shape our beliefs about money, either fostering prosperity or limiting it. If a child frequently hears phrases like “Money is evil” or “Rich people are dishonest,” these ideas may take root and later become barriers to financial independence.
Subconscious Beliefs About Money: Where Do They Come From?
The first source of financial beliefs is childhood experiences and upbringing. As children, we form our worldview based on the words and actions of our parents. If money was a source of constant arguments in the family, a child might conclude that finances cause problems. If parents often said that “money is hard to earn,” this belief can carry into adulthood.
Another major factor is societal norms and collective beliefs. Society propagates myths about money: “You can’t get rich honestly,” “Money corrupts people,” “You must save on everything.” These messages are reinforced through media, books, films, and conversations, subtly shaping a person’s limiting beliefs.
Over time, these negative ideas solidify into deep-seated convictions, which unconsciously dictate our behavior and relationship with money. Without awareness and conscious effort, changing one’s financial reality is challenging.
